Output 9696aafcb32c93aa191ed3ebe3d1cdf50308a2f07fbcf75f5a1cc76dd8631e6d:14

value
73766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25604f90dcf88fb4fc8b4ec37641e84a853d417b OP_EQUAL
address
356eJS6ShfgxAgSPaUtmSS6b71iam8wSpf
transaction
9696aafcb32c93aa191ed3ebe3d1cdf50308a2f07fbcf75f5a1cc76dd8631e6d